    Crafting Effective Emails to Google Customer Service

    Okay, so you've found an email address for Google customer service – fantastic! But sending a well-crafted email is just as important as finding the right address. Here's how to ensure your email is clear, concise, and gets you the help you need. First, make sure your subject line is specific and informative. Instead of something generic like "Help needed," use a subject like "Gmail account access issue" or "YouTube channel monetization problem." This helps the support team quickly understand the nature of your inquiry and direct it to the appropriate department. Next, be clear and concise in your email body. State your problem in a straightforward manner, avoiding jargon or overly technical language. Provide all the necessary information, such as your Google account email address, the product or service you're having trouble with, and any error messages you're seeing. Include details like the date and time when the issue occurred, as well as any steps you've already taken to try and resolve the problem. Remember, the more information you provide, the better equipped the support team will be to help you. Always be polite and respectful in your email, even if you're frustrated. Remember, the support representatives are there to assist you, and a positive tone will go a long way in getting your issue resolved quickly. Finally, proofread your email before sending it. Check for any typos or grammatical errors, as they can detract from the professionalism of your communication.     Troubleshooting Tips Before Contacting Google

    Before you reach out to Google customer service via email, it's always a good idea to try some basic troubleshooting steps yourself. This can often resolve your issue quickly and save you some time. First, make sure you've restarted your device. A simple reboot can fix a lot of temporary glitches. Next, clear your browser's cache and cookies. This can help resolve website-related issues. If you're having trouble with a specific app, try updating it to the latest version. Outdated apps can sometimes cause problems. Check your internet connection. Make sure you have a stable and reliable internet connection. If you're using Wi-Fi, try switching to a different network or using a wired connection. Also, make sure that your account is in good standing. Check if your account is not suspended or if you have any outstanding payments. Go through any available FAQs and Help pages. These resources often provide solutions to common problems. By taking these preliminary steps, you might be able to resolve your issue without having to contact support.     What to Expect After Sending Your Email

    So, you've sent your email to Google customer service – what now? Knowing what to expect after sending your email can help you manage your expectations and follow up effectively. First and foremost, be patient. Response times can vary depending on the complexity of your issue, the volume of inquiries, and the specific service you're contacting. Generally, you can expect to receive an initial response within 24 to 72 hours. However, some issues might take longer to resolve. Keep an eye on your inbox, including your spam and junk folders, as replies from Google sometimes end up there. When you receive a response, carefully review the information provided. The support team might ask for additional details, request screenshots, or provide instructions on how to resolve your issue. Respond promptly to their requests to keep the process moving forward. If you don't receive a response within a reasonable timeframe, don't hesitate to follow up. You can reply to your original email and ask for an update on the status of your request. Be polite and reiterate your issue. If you're still not getting the help you need, consider using other support channels, such as the Google Help Center or their social media accounts.
